Verdicts in Hong Kong’s biggest trial against democratic opposition come >3 yrs after police arrested 47 #democrats in raids at homes across the city. They were charged w/ #conspiracy to commit subversion under a #NationalSecurity law imposed by #China.
…The defendants are accused of a "vicious plot" to paralyse #government in the fmr British colony & to force the city's leader to resign through a pre-selection ballot in a July 2020 citywide election. The #democrats maintain it was an unofficial attempt to select the strongest candidates in a bid to win a historic majority in #HongKong's legislature.
Beijing in 2020 imposed the sweeping #NationalSecurity#law that led to a spate of #arrests of democratic campaigners as well as closures of #liberal#media outlets & #NGOs. Hong Kong's democratic opposition had sought for decades to pressure Beijing to allow full #democracy in the city.

Charismatic #MakeUpArtist Sapphire Shen is passionate about her career. The 31 yr old #HongKong resident describes her work as an art form that can enhance a person’s facial features to accentuate an outfit and look & boost their self-confidence.
For more than a decade, Shen has lived with #lupus, a chronic #autoimmune#disease that mostly affects women & afflicts an estimated 7,000 people in Hong Kong and 5 million worldwide.
#Singapore’s private #homes again ranked as the #MostExpensive in #AsiaPacific with a median price of $1.32 million in 2023, after an influx of #WealthyImmigrants helped push that figure up 9.6% from the previous year, according to the Urban Land Institute’s 2024 ULI Asia Pacific Home Attainability Index published Tuesday.
Homes in #HongKong ranked as the 2nd most expensive in the region with a median price of $1.16 million..
